摘要: 采用两步法合成了一系列组分不同的水溶性苯乙烯/ 丙烯酸酯改性醇酸树脂。 采用 FT-IR、1H-NMR和 GPC 分别对树脂的结构、组成及相对分子质量进行了表征。 测定了由合成树脂制备的清漆的性能,包括漆膜干燥时间、铅笔硬度、附着力、耐水和耐碱性能。 结果表明:改性醇酸树脂具有良好的物理机械性能。

Abstract: A series of styrene/ acrylate modified waterborne alkyd resin with different ratio of styrene and acrylate were synthesized via a two-step process. The structure, component and molecular weight of the modified alkyd resins were characterized by FT-IR, 1H-NMR and GPC. A vamish was prepared by diluting the said resin with water and its film performance was determined in terms of drying time, pencil hardness, adhesion, resistance to water and alkaline. The results showed that the styrene/ acrylate molar ratio 1: 1.6) modified waterbome alkyd resin exhibited exce lent physical properties.
